Lithium-ion batteries are rechargeable energy storage devices that have revolutionized the way we power our devices. These batteries are characterized by high energy density, low self-discharge rates, and minimal memory effect. The 7.6V configuration specifically means that it can deliver a steady voltage output suitable for various applications, making it a popular choice in consumer electronics, electric vehicles, and much more.
One of the defining features of the 7.6V 4200mAh lithium-ion battery is its performance. With a capacity of 4200mAh, it can provide a continuous output of 4.2A for one hour, or proportionally lower currents for more extended periods. This makes it ideal for devices like drones, RC cars, or portable devices demanding substantial power.
Moreover, lithium-ion batteries are known for their longevity. With appropriate care, these batteries can last for several hundred charge cycles before their capacity diminishes significantly. To optimize battery lifespan, it’s advisable to avoid complete discharges and keep them between 20% and 80% charge whenever possible.
The versatility of these batteries allows them to be used in various fields:
From smartphones to laptops, the 7.6V 4200mAh lithium-ion battery is integral to many consumer devices. Its ability to provide a high energy density in a relatively small footprint makes it suitable for devices where space is a constraint.
In the realm of electric mobility, these batteries offer crucial performance benefits. They can be used to power bikes, scooters, and even small cars, providing the necessary energy for a practical range while ensuring efficient energy use.
Robotic applications, including autonomous drones and robotic arms, often require high-capacity batteries. The 7.6V 4200mAh battery can offer the necessary energy density to keep robots functioning for hours, making it a staple choice for hobbyists and industry professionals alike.

The future of lithium-ion batteries looks promising. As technology advances, we can expect innovations that will address existing challenges:
Research is ongoing into new materials and chemistries that could lead to greater energy density, enhanced safety, and lower costs. Innovations such as solid-state batteries may offer promising solutions moving forward.
As environmental concerns grow, many manufacturers are exploring ways to make lithium-ion batteries more sustainable. This includes developing recycling programs and sustainable sourcing of raw materials.
The pairing of lithium-ion batteries with renewable energy sources such as solar and wind power is becoming increasingly popular. This integration will allow for more reliable energy systems and contribute to a more sustainable future.
